What is the surface area of a cone that has a radius of 8 feet and a slant height of 12 feet? (Use 3.14 for π.)

301.44 ft 2
502.4 ft 2
200.96 ft 2
803.84 ft 2​

Answer:

Surface area of cone is
502.4\ ft^2

Explanation:

Given:

radius of a cone (r) = 8 feet

slant height of cone (l) = 12 feet

We need to find the surface area of cone.

Total surface area of cone = Area of circle
+ Area of curved surface

Now we know that,

Area of circle =
\pi r^2

Area of curved surface =
\pi rl

Hence Total surface area of cone =
\pi r^2+\pi rl=\pi r(r+l) = 3.14 * 8 (8+12)=3.14*8*20= 502.4 \ ft^2

Surface area of cone is
502.4\ ft^2.
